Security Engineer
ON-SITE POSITION

Job Description Summary
Responsible for assisting the Director of IT Security and Compliance with the security-related design, implementation, and support ofinfrastructure and systems. Assists with ensuring that all technology platforms and systems are protected against threats and vulnerabilities while maintaining their overall integrity and security.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ities (other duties may be assigned)


  • Assist with ensuring all technology platforms and systems are protected against threats and vulnerabilities while maintaining their overall integrity and security.
  • Work with internal and external resources on designing, configuring, implementing, and troubleshooting I.T. Security applications and systems.
  • Detect, investigate and respond to I.T. Security related incidents.
  • Identify and define security requirements for operating systems and applications.
  • Assist with the creation, development, and maintenance of I.T. security-related policies, procedures, and standards documentation.
  • Participate in vulnerability detection and associated remediation efforts
  • Ensures completion of regular reviews of system-generated security-log exception reports and compliance sampling of internal and regulatory policies, procedures, standards and controls.
  • Ensure all systems operate in accordance with all applicable Tribal regulatory controls, federal standards (PCI, GDPR , CCPA, etc.).
  • Maintain knowledge of current and emerging vulnerabilities, malware, infiltration techniques, forensics, and threats.
  • Perform internal and external (vendors, contractors, consultants) vulnerability assessments to identify weaknesses and assess the effectiveness of existing controls.
  • Assist with audit requests for documentation, responses and remediation.
  • Assist with I.T. Security training and User Awareness Programs.
  • Assist the I.T. teams with identifying and resolving I.T. security-related issues.
  • Implement education and training programs on information security and privacy matters for team members and other authorized users.
  • Develop, implement and maintain risk assessment, incident reporting and response systems, to address security breaches, policy violations and grievances from external parties.
  • Participate in investigations of situations in which security may have been compromised and notify IT management of any unusual transactions impacting system security.
  • Work closely with other IT security leadership on ensuring system enhancements do not compromise compliance requirements or security standards.
  • Develop and maintain collaborative partnerships with all relevant internal departments as well as external vendors, regarding IT security-related information technology solutions.
  • Keep abreast of the latest I.T. security and privacy legislation, regulations, advisories, alerts and vulnerabilities and develops implementation strategies to ensure the company's security program and software remain current and secure.
  • Provide outstanding customer service in a timely manner to both guests and fellow team members.
  • Backup Cyber Security Analyst II as required

    Education and/or Experience


    • Minimum of three years of I.T. security experience plus an additional 2 years of experience in I.T. security administration, server administration or network administration
    • Industry certification (such as CompTIA Security+, CySA+, or similar) is highly desired.
    • Experience with I.T. security systems, including firewalls, endpoint protection, SSO, authentication systems, MDM, log management, content filtering, remote access, etc.
    • Experience with and understanding of the NIST Cyber Security Framework.
    • Experience with multiple industry-leading security testing environments and tools, as well as, network assessment tools such as SIEM, Nessus, Tenable Security Center
    • Working knowledge of Tribal compliance, regulations and standards preferred
    • Problem-solving skills and the ability to work under pressure in a constantly evolving environment.
    • Must have a reliable means of transportation
    • Willing and able to work any and all shifts as assigned, including weekends and holidays
    • Must possess excellent written and verbal communication skills. Must be able to communicate in English.
    • Bachelor's degree in computer science or information sciences from a four-year college or university, an equivalent combination of education and experience will be considered.
